My wife and I just returned from the Mexican Riviera cruise on the Oosterdam. We had a terrific time. I don't have time to write up a full review, but here are some general observations and notes.

 

The Ship itself was very nice. I really liked the decor around it. I think I filled up half my camera card just on decorations. It seemed like everything was also easy to find. Of course it could of helped that we had a room right in the center of the ship. Nothing looked to beat up or in need of repairs. Overall I would give the ship an 8 out of 10.

 

Dining: I liked the come when you want dining option. We went to dinner a different time each night and sat with different people each night. All made for fun conversations and getting to know more people. The food was decent most nights. There was never anything that blew my mind away in the main dining room. However, we did eat at the Pinnacle Grill one night and the Caesar Salad was amazing. I am still thinking about it. The dining staff at both were attentive and took care of us. Lido food options were pretty good too we always ate breakfast and lunch there.

 

Cabin: Our cabin was nice and roomy with a decent size balcony. Our steward was like a ninja even if we left for a few minutes he was in to clean it.

 

Front Office: This was the only problem I had on the ship. For some reason that had us listed as two separate spending accounts instead of one and it was doing weird things with my credit card authorizations. We asked them on Sunday to combine it to one. They assured us it would be. However we had to go back every day until Friday before it was done.

 

Mazatlan: Mazatlan was nice once we made it past the wave of people who want you to do a tour or get a cab ride. We took a cab over to old town to walk around the market. Then over to the golden zone for shopping and lunch.The area was a little pushy though at each store. But we have cruised enough to get over that now.

 

Puerto Vallarta: Was a very nice port, we did a ship excursion. City, Country and Tequilla. It was a good tour. I did feel bad for the guy who drank tequialla on the tour. He didn't look like he was happy coming back from it. Then there was one family who showed up to the pier at 4pm even though all aboard was at 3:30. I guess thankfully the ship was still there.

 

Cabo San Lucas: We snorkeled here and just walked around the shops at the marina. Other then being a tender port it was great.

 

All in all it was a great cruise. If you go on it, I highly recommend splurging and getting the hydrotherapy room package from the spa. It is very nice and you will appreciate it after being on port all day.
